4-18 ROKEBY. CANTO 1L Twice from my glance it seem'd to flee And shroud itself by cliff or tree. How think'st thou?-Is our path way-laid? Or hath thy sire my trust betray'd? If so"-Ere, starting from his dream, That turn'd upon a gentler theme, Wilfrid had rous'd him to reply, Bertram sprung forward, shouting high, "Whate'er thou art, thou now shalt staurl.' And forth he darted, sword in hand. XIV. As bursts the levin in its wrath, He shot him down the sounding path; Rock, wood, and stream, rang wildly out, To his loud step and savage shout. Seems that the object of his race iath scal'd the cliffs; his frantic chase Sidelong he turns, and now'tis bent Right up the rock's tall battlement; Straining each sinew to ascend, Foot, hand, and knee, their aid must len(d Wilfrid, all dizzy with dismay, Views, from beneath, his dreadful way: Now to the oak's warp'd roots he clings, Now trusts his weight to ivy strings; Now, like the wild goat, mus he dare An unsupported leap in air; Hid in the shrubby rain-course now, You mark him by the crashing bough, And by his conlet's sullen clank, And by the stones spurn'd from the bal. And by the hawk scar'd from her ntesL And ravens croaking o'er their guest Who deem his forfeit limbs shall pay The tribute of his bold essay. XV. See, he emerges —desp'rate now All farther course —Yon beetling brow, In craggy nakedness sublime, What heart or foot shall dare to climb? It bears no tendril for his clasp, Presents no angle to his grasp: Sole stay his foot may rest upon, Is yon earth-bedded jetting stone.
